Echoes Across Continents is not just a dance production; it is a global cultural journey crafted by *Bappaz Entertainment & FilmZ* under the visionary direction of **Shreekant Dnyandev Ahire**. This performance celebrates the timeless truth that no matter where we come from, rhythm is our common language and dance is our shared heartbeat. The show brings together India’s most vibrant classical and folk traditions with powerful international dance styles, creating a dialogue of unity and diversity on stage.
From Maharashtra comes **Lavani**, bold and expressive, celebrated for its fast footwork and emotional storytelling.
Facing it is *Tap Dance* from America, where metal shoes strike the floor with jazzy rhythm and unstoppable energy.
Together they prove that whether ghungroos or tap shoes, rhythm knows no boundaries.
From North India comes **Kathak**, spinning endlessly with graceful chakkars and poetic gestures.
From Spain comes **Flamenco**, fiery and passionate with stamping heels and clapping hands.
Together they create a storm of grace and fire, devotion and rebellion merging as one.
From Gujarat comes **Garba**, joyous circular formations danced during Navratri.
From Austria comes **Viennese Waltz**, elegant circles gliding across palaces.
Together they turn circles into a universal symbol of celebration and harmony.
Beyond these acts, the show explores fusions like **Bharatanatyam with Ballet**, **Odissi with Contemporary**, **Yakshagana with Kabuki**, and **Kalaripayattu with Capoeira**. Each pairing is short yet powerful, reminding us that cultures are echoes of each other, reflections across continents.
Echoes Across Continents begins with these powerful glimpses of rhythm and storytelling, but its heart lies not only in the performances — its soul lies in the message of unity, the creative journey, and the passion of the team behind it.
Behind the glittering stage of Echoes Across Continents lies months of planning, research, and hard work. Every performance that looks effortless under the spotlight is actually the result of countless hours of rehearsals, costume trials, stage design discussions, and music editing sessions. This production was not only about presenting dances but about presenting cultures with dignity and authenticity. That is why the creative journey behind this show is as inspiring as the acts themselves.
The first step was research. Each dancer had to understand not only their own tradition but also the counterpart with which they would perform. Lavani dancers studied the energy of Tap, Kathak dancers practiced claps to understand Flamenco palmas, Garba performers visualized ballroom glides of Waltz, and martial artists from Kalaripayattu explored Capoeira’s playful combat. This cross-cultural learning became a bridge that made the show feel honest and authentic.
Then came rehearsals. For weeks, dancers came together in large studios, practicing from morning till night. Mistakes turned into corrections, corrections turned into patterns, and patterns turned into choreography. Every footstep had to be aligned, every clap synchronized, every circle perfected. Dancers had to not only perform but also trust each other, because in a fusion act, balance is everything. If one misses a beat, the entire dialogue breaks. That is why the rehearsals were not just about dance; they were about building unity in diversity even within the team.
Costume design was another journey. Lavani costumes required nauvari sarees with bold jewelry, Tap required sleek Western attire, Kathak needed lehengas and ghungroos, Flamenco demanded long frilled dresses, Garba demanded vibrant chaniya-cholis, and Waltz required elegant gowns and tuxedos. Each costume was created carefully so that even when two styles stood side by side, they retained their identity while complementing each other visually. It was like painting with different colors on one canvas — each color visible, yet together creating a masterpiece.
Stage design and graphics played a vital role too. This was not just a performance but an experience. LED screens displayed Vrindavan ghats when Kathak performed, Spanish courtyards when Flamenco entered, Gujarati chowks during Garba, and Viennese ballrooms for the Waltz. Transitions were seamless so that the audience felt they were traveling across continents in seconds. The combination of live human energy and digital backdrops created a magical illusion that made the show unforgettable.
